dll编写入门到精通教程 unity3djs和webjs的区别?
unity3djs和webjs的区别?
unity中的js还不如说是js,不如说是UnityScript。unity中的js是会经过编译程序的,其性能和本地速度也差不多。在官方教材《unity 4.x从入门到精通》中unity称C#,Boo,JS的性能是也差不多的。
unity中的js脚本是是可以和C#脚本等值修改成的,所以肯定也有一大堆数据类型,对象继承等悠久的传统语言及OOP的概念。
不过vartorque5这么写也是可以的,因为编译器会自动启动表述成varspeed:int5。但其他数据类型诸如GameObject、Transform就不行啦,可以在声明变量时指定你数据类型。
自然,很多标准js中的特性在unity中也不接受,诸如五阶函数,闭包等。
Unity3D中的Math对象叫暗Mathf。Unity中的js可以直接内部函数Mono,C#整体封装的dll等。
Unity中的调试语句用Debug.Log。每行后面要有分号。
其实,Unity中的js是会在运行前被编译成本地代码的。和标准js仅是写法都很有几分相似,内在是完全差别的。
诸如js是非阻塞的,而unity中的js是造成堵塞的;js是动态语言,而unity中的js则是名副其实的支持静态语言。因此前端攻城狮们要想熟练的掌握掌握untiy的js的话最好就是的方法那就是多建议参考官方的js脚本,完全相信上手我还是迅速的,虽说语法很有几分相似。
如何将dll文件添加到cad?
这对将dll文件添加到CAD的方法如下:
一、真接放在你AUTOCAD的安装路径下(就像系统默认的是在C:ProgramFilesAutoCAD)。
二、工具-加载应用程序-你选所选的.dll文件-打开程序。
参考文献:《CAD入门教程》,《CAD从入门到精通》,《AutoCAD 2014实用教程——基础篇(中文版书)》
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。